Engineer - Design Wet Utilities (AL Ain)
We are seeking a detail-oriented and analytical Engineer – Design Wet Utilities to join our team in AL Ain. In this role, you will be responsible for designing and overseeing the implementation of water supply, wastewater, and stormwater systems for various projects in the region.
Responsibilities- Develop comprehensive designs for wet utilities systems, including water distribution networks, sewage collection systems, and stormwater management facilities
- Perform hydraulic calculations and modeling to ensure optimal system performance and efficiency
- Create detailed technical drawings, specifications, and reports using CAD software
- Collaborate with multidisciplinary teams to integrate wet utilities designs with other project components
- Ensure compliance with local and international design standards, regulations, and environmental requirements
- Conduct site visits to assess existing conditions and monitor project progress
- Provide technical support and guidance to junior engineers and drafters
- Participate in client meetings and presentations to discuss project requirements and design solutions
- Manage project schedules, budgets, and resources to meet deadlines and quality standards
- Stay updated on industry trends, innovative technologies, and best practices in wet utilities design
- Bachelor's degree in Civil Engineering or a related field
- Professional Engineer (PE) license preferred
- Minimum of 2 years of experience in wet utilities design, focused on water supply, wastewater, and stormwater systems
- Proficiency in AutoCAD or similar CAD software for creating detailed technical drawings
- Experience with hydraulic modeling software for system analysis and optimization
- Strong knowledge of local and international wet utilities design standards and regulations
- Understanding of environmental impact assessments related to wet utilities projects
- Excellent project management skills, including the ability to manage schedules, budgets, and resources
- Proficiency in Microsoft Office Suite for report writing and data analysis
- Strong analytical and problem‑solving skills to address complex engineering challenges
- Excellent communication and interpersonal skills for collaborating with team members and clients
- Ability to work effectively in a fast‑paced, multicultural environment
- Willingness to travel to project sites within the United Arab Emirates as needed
